Transaction 6c326031a16721ee6139a7c07cb0bacc5f6c6e90f8013088778933b1a0150d03
1 Input
1 Output
-
6c326031a16721ee6139a7c07cb0bacc5f6c6e90f8013088778933b1a0150d03:0
- value
- 25867
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ee182181d1580d1e074334b3800425e3e547b88
- address
- bc1qdmscyxqazkqdrcr5xd9nsqzztcl9g7ug9rmfnm